- Title
Nodal Spectral Weight and Fermi Surface in La[sub 2-x]Sr[sub x]CuO[sub 4].
- Authors
Yoshida, T.; Nakamura, M.; Ino, A.; Mizokawa, T.; Fujimori, A.; Zhou, X. J.; Kellar, S. A.; Bogdanov, P. V.; Lu, E. D.; Lanzara, A.; Eisaki, H.; Hussain, Z.; Shen, Z.-X.; Kakeshita, T.; Uchida, S.
- Abstract
We present spectral weight mapping in the momentum space for La[sub 2-x]Sr[sub x]CuO[sub 4] using angle-resolved photoemission spectroscopy. The spectral weight of the nodal states, which shows suppression in previous results, is enhanced and shows sharp peaks in the second Brillouin zone for the overdoped sample due to matrix element effects, although they remain much weaker than the other cuprates.
